Hi Toni ![]()
We expect Greeceās land, air, and sea borders will be opened on July 1st if not earlier. Since weāre doing exceptionally well and have very few new cases on a daily basis, the re-opening date may be brought forward as early as June 15. It depends on the situation over the next couple of weeks.
Greece is not going to enforce a 14-day quarantine on people arriving to the country but they will need to test negative for covid-19 before departing their home country.
The Greek government is planning to conduct temperature checks on people arriving at airports and land borders. Health questionnaires will also be given to all arrivals.
The EU has left it up to each individual country to decide on travel restrictions which means it will be up to Greece and the UK to make a bilateral agreement to allow travel between the two countries. Greece is keen on you being allowed to come this summer so I hope the covid-19 situation improves enough in the UK to give your government the confidence it needs to allow you to travel safely.
Weāre expecting new announcements from the Greek government tomorrow and over the next few weeks.
